Score 93/100 · Drink 2024-2031, Jeb Dunnuck, Dec 2024

Based on 2020, but also including 40% perpetual reserve wines dating back to 2005, the NV Champagne Extra Brut Rosé is 94% Chardonnay, with the rest Pinot Noir from Verzy and Verzenay. Aged 30 months, with 5.5 grams per liter dosage, it pours a medium salmon hue and is very pretty on the nose, with aromas of fresh peaches, candied orange, fresh flowers, strawberries, and delicate pastry dough. Medium-bodied, it has a bit more intensity on the palate, and while it’s approachable, it retains a nice balance of tension and freshness of chalky texture to lift it on the palate, with a hint of spice. The mousse is lively and zesty, and it has a clean finish with a kiss of bitter almond. Drink this charming wine over the next 4-6 years. 30,000 bottles produced. This is my first time tasting the Champagne of Barons De Rothschild. They work with 85 hectares, mainly in Montagne de Reims and in the Côte de Blancs.
